## Rate-Parity Checker — Restart Procedure

1. Drain the Fairfare worker pool.
2. Clear the comparison cache; stale rates cause false parity alerts.
3. Redeploy the checker with the latest rate-source manifest.
4. Verify three sample properties report matching rates.

The checker must re-authenticate to the internal rates service on startup using the key below.

app token of yajeg-kawef = kto11_7En3XSX8xQw

- [ ] Step 7: Archive cold storage buckets (Glacierline tier). Confirm both ceremony witnesses are present, verify bucket manifests match the Oxbow ledger, then seal the archive key shares. Plugin authors may observe but not handle shares. Once sealed, the archive index itself is encrypted and can only be reopened with the passphrase below.

vault phrase of badup-hahig = tamael-aldael-kelmir-istael-fenok-istwyn-tamius-jorath-oliion

Quarterly Planning Note — Hiring Freeze, Calder Division

For the incoming director: the Calder division is under a hiring freeze through end of fiscal year. Open requisitions are cancelled; backfills require sign-off from group HR. Contractor conversions are paused. Headcount targets for other divisions are unaffected. The reasoning is outlined in the note below.

internal memo for hahaf-kahof: Only 39 of the 428 pilot accounts renewed Sorion, so a churn review is set for April 12. Praokix Freight is in early talks to buy Queniusox Group for about $145.8 million.

Runbook — PuzzleForge grid service. If daily crossword generation stalls, first confirm the WordVault dictionary mount is readable, then check the fill-queue depth. A depth above 50 usually means the theme-entry solver is looping; restart the solver pod only after capturing a heap dump. Before restarting anything, verify the running settings match the approved configuration shown below.

deployment values, yadug-bawif:
[framir]
team = pelox
access_code = ac_a38ab2
owner = tamion.julael
host = framir.tolvaqlabs.test
port = 11211
peer = tammir.zemvargrid.local
salt = 2215ef03
pin = 1541